Lovers of the great outdoors ‘flock’ to the Harrier’s Nest – our cosy, country cottage in Kent.This charming countryside cottage is a natural pick for small families or groups of friends seeking peace, comfort, and views that soothe the soul. With two bedrooms and a welcoming, rustic style, Harrier’s Nest offers a relaxing escape in the heart of the Kent countryside.
Its wood-clad exterior and perfect symmetry creates an instantly inviting first impression, while the interior feels like a true home-from-home. The snug lounge catches the light through French doors, looking out onto open farmland – perfect for curling up after a countryside ramble.
Across the hallway, the kitchen-diner offers a different but equally calming view: the Mocketts Farm duck pond. Fully equipped with everything needed for a fuss-free self-catering stay, it’s a place to cook, chat, and eat at your own pace. You’ll also enjoy extras like free WiFi, Freeview TVs, and a thoughtful welcome basket to get you started.
Upstairs, the two bedrooms (set up as doubles or twins) are a cosy mix of soft neutrals, deep woods and warming tones – inviting spaces to relax and recharge after a day in the fresh air.
Outside your door, there’s even more to enjoy. Guests share access to the onsite games room and a fully enclosed 2-acre dog paddock*, while just down the road is The Ferry House – our award-winning restaurant offering a true taste of Harty with homegrown and foraged ingredients on every plate. Just a short stroll from the cottage, our 2AA Rosette restaurant, The Ferry House, serves breakfast, lunch and dinner with views over the Swale estuary. It’s dog-friendly, with private dining available for groups. Pre-booking is essential, as opening hours may vary due to private events.
In-cottage catering is also available, including heat-and-serve traybakes, grazing boards and brunch platters.
From April 2026, The Ferry House will open only for special dining events, with private dining and events, and in-cottage catering continuing.
